使用Postman进行微信支付接口的后端调试

118 篇文章 ¥59.90 ¥99.00
本文介绍了如何使用Postman调试微信支付的后端接口,包括准备、创建请求、设置请求头和参数、发送请求以及调试排错。通过示例代码展示实际操作流程,帮助开发人员高效验证接口正确性。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

在开发微信支付的后端接口时,为了验证接口的正确性和准确性,可以使用Postman进行流畅的接口调试。Postman是一款常用的API开发工具,提供了强大的功能,可以帮助开发人员发送HTTP请求、测试接口、调试代码等。本文将介绍如何使用Postman进行微信支付接口的后端调试,并提供相应的源代码示例。

  1. 准备工作
    在开始之前,需要确保已经完成以下准备工作:
  • 安装Postman:你可以从Postman官网下载并安装最新版本的Postman。
  • 获取微信支付接口文档:前往微信支付官网,下载相关的开发文档和API接口文档,了解接口的参数和请求方式。
  1. 创建请求
    首先,我们需要创建一个新的请求。在Postman界面的左上角,点击"New"按钮,选择"Request"。然后,输入请求的URL,选择请求的方法(通常是POST),并设置所需的请求头和参数。

  2. 设置请求头
    微信支付接口通常要求在请求头中携带特定的信息,例如商户号、API密钥等。在Postman的请求界面,点击"Headers"选项卡,然后添加所需的请求头信息。根据微信支付接口文档提供的要求,添加相应的请求头参数。

  3. 设置

### 如何使用 IntelliJ IDEA 开发微信小程序的后端服务 #### 工具准备 IntelliJ IDEA 是一款功能强大的集成开发环境,适用于 Java 和其他编程语言。对于微信小程序的后端开发,通常采用基于 Spring Boot 的框架来构建 RESTful API 接口[^1]。 #### 创建项目 在 IntelliJ IDEA 中创建一个新的 Maven 或 Gradle 项目,并引入必要的依赖项。Spring Boot 提供了丰富的 Starter POMs 来简化常见的开发场景。以下是典型的 `pom.xml` 文件中的部分配置: ```xml <dependencies> <!-- Spring Web --> <dependency> <groupId>org.springframework.boot</groupId> <artifactId>spring-boot-starter-web</artifactId> </dependency> <!-- MySQL Connector --> <dependency> <groupId>mysql</groupId> <artifactId>mysql-connector-java</artifactId> <scope>runtime</scope> </dependency> <!-- MyBatis Plus ORM Framework --> <dependency> <groupId>com.baomidou</groupId> <artifactId>mybatis-plus-boot-starter</artifactId> <version>3.4.2</version> </dependency> </dependencies> ``` 上述代码片段展示了如何通过 Maven 添加 Spring Web 支持以及数据库连接所需的依赖项。 #### 配置 `.idea` 文件夹的作用 `.idea` 文件夹由 JetBrains 系列工具(如 PyCharm、IntelliJ IDEA)自动生成,用于存储项目的元数据信息,例如编码设置、模块定义和运行配置等。如果删除该文件夹,则可能导致重新加载项目时丢失个性化设置[^2]。 #### 架构设计与实现 微信小程序后端的核心任务之一是提供稳定的数据交互接口。以下是一个简单的控制器示例,展示如何处理来自前端的小程序请求并返回 JSON 数据响应: ```java @RestController @RequestMapping("/api/user") public class UserController { @GetMapping("/{id}") public ResponseEntity<UserDto> getUserById(@PathVariable Long id) { User user = userService.findById(id); if (user != null) { return new ResponseEntity<>(new UserDto(user), HttpStatus.OK); } else { return new ResponseEntity<>(HttpStatus.NOT_FOUND); } } } ``` 此代码段说明了一个基础的 GET 请求处理器方法,它接收路径参数并将查询结果封装成 DTO 对象返回给客户端应用[^3]。 #### 测试与调试 利用 Postman 或者类似的 HTTP 客户端工具可以方便地测试已发布的 API 功能是否正常工作;同时也可以借助单元测试框架 JUnit 编写自动化验证脚本以提高代码质量。 ---
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值